Laws Committee Confirms Bill on How to Achieve Rights

Monday, August 10, 2015
Kabul (BNA) Second Vice President, Sarwar Danesh chairing the law committee meeting, called the laws on how to achieve the rights and support the amortization very significant, BNA reported the other day.
He lauded the efforts made by the ministry of justice and other related administrations for providing and arrangement of the draft laws.
He said an administration by the name of Rights Administration had been established within the ministry of Interior in 1940 and within the ministry of justice in 1964, to investigate the rights pleas in the center and provinces of the country.
In 1987, the laws are reinvestigated after nearly 30 years, said the vice-president adding the main aim of the laws was to fully preview the cases before referring the court.
The committee after hearing the members’ opinions on the law, instructed the ministry of justice to fully assess the vision and lodge them into the law draft for approval.
The law on supporting the amortization was also discussed at the meeting, with the committee tasked some related organs including representatives from the ministries of justice, finance, commerce and industries, economy, local organs administration, chamber of commerce and industries to assess the law and discuss at the next meeting of the committee.
